Lou's Automotive Center is located on South Black Horse Pike in Blackwood. It is an Auto Value Certified repair station, and all its mechanics are ASE certified. The shop does routine maintenance as well as repairs on foreign and domestic vehicles. Lou's services and repairs brakes, exhaust systems, electrical issues, steering, transmissions and much more.